Failure mode
The title is phrased as a claim but only asserts a truism or a point nobody knowledgeable would contest.
Test
Ask whether someone informed could reasonably argue the opposite. If not, the claim is weak.
The fix is usually to sharpen the title to the non-obvious point the note actually establishes, or to switch to a topical title when the note is not making a contestable claim.
Topical titles remain valid for multi-claim specs, frameworks, definitional notes, indexes, and exploratory drafts.
Example (fail)
continuous learning is substrate-independentvalidation should be fast
Example (pass)
continuous learning can happen outside of weightsdeterministic validation should be a script
